a.mon denotes the remaining body of people carried into exile in Jeremiah 52:15.

In Jeremiah 52:15, a.mon identifies the remaining body of people included among those carried into exile.

Senses in use

  1. remaining body of people · dominant

    The singular absolute noun occurs in the clause listing people taken away: in Jeremiah 52:15 the APB renders the surrounding clause as “and the rest of the multitude,” before saying that Nebuzaradan carried them into exile.

In the Anselm Project Bible: In Jeremiah 52:15, the APB presents the term within the phrase “the rest of the multitude.” That phrase indicates the clause's presentation rather than isolating the term's exact English equivalent.
